Security

Visitors/Volunteers

Please enter through the front doors. All visitors and/or volunteers must sign-in and pick-up your volunteer name tag or visitor tag.

Supervision

Teachers are outside for supervision from 7:45 to 8:00 AM each morning and during recess 10:01 to 10:15 AM. Lunchroom supervisors are on lunch duty from 11:45 to 12:30 PM. There is no supervision at the end of the school day. Students should go home after school before returning to the school playground.

Doors

Each grade enters and exits through a designated door. Parents with multiple students will meet at the door of the youngest student.

​Lockdowns

All CBE schools are required to practice lockdowns in the same way that we practice fire drills. The procedures for lockdowns are developed with the Calgary Police Service and are part of each school’s Emergency Response Plan. If you have questions about lockdown drills or lockdown procedures, please contact your principal.
 

Evacuation Procedures

In the event that the school needs to be evacuated for any reason, all staff have been trained according to CBE standards. All schools have a primary and a secondary evacuation site. In the event of an evacuation, you will receive an email, phone or SMS notification from the school.
